Scan And Repair

The "Scan And Repair" PowerShell script is a script designed for system analysis, maintenance, and reporting. The script leverages various built-in and custom PowerShell functions to automate common troubleshooting and diagnostic tasks. The following is a breakdown of the key features and details about the latest version of the script:

Features

  • Hardware Scan & Reporting: Generates a report of the machine's battery status and exports it to a viewable HTML file.
  • Operating System Analysis: Executes SFC Scan, DISM Scan, and collects relevant logs for further analysis.
  • Storage Management: Retrieves a list of connected disks, performs disk cleanup, and calculates the amount of space cleaned.
  • Network Diagnostics: Captures network configurations, performs ARP, and initiates ping requests to diagnose network connectivity issues.

Usage

The script is structured to be run as a whole, and it automates multiple tasks across different aspects of system analysis and maintenance. To use the script:

  1. Download the script file to a local directory.
  2. Open PowerShell with administrative privileges.
  3. Navigate to the directory where the script is located using the cd command.
  4. Run the script by entering its filename (e.g., .\ScanAndRepair.ps1) and press Enter.

Future Enhancements

The script shares heavy inspirations from TronScript and aims to incorporate additional functionality such as running TronScript as a "final clean," executing ClamAV scans, exporting reliability reports and battery scans, gathering system specifications, and compiling comprehensive reports.
